Business Opportunities in Jamaica
Jamaica presents a wealth of promising business opportunities in a variety of sectors. With its strategic location in the Caribbean, the island offers a gateway to the broader region and beyond. Key industries for investment and growth include tourism, agriculture, renewable energy, information technology, logistics, and manufacturing. The country’s business-friendly environment promotes a range of incentives, including tax breaks and investment support. A skilled workforce, a well-developed infrastructure, and strong government support further enhance the appeal of Jamaica as a destination for business expansion and innovation.
